What Is Sleep Apnea?

Sleep apnea is a serious sleep disorder in which breathing repeatedly stops and restarts during sleep, depriving the brain and body of oxygen.

Obstructive sleep apnea (OSA) is the most prevalent form, occurring when throat muscles relax excessively during sleep and block the airway. Each breathing pause — called an apnea — can last 10 seconds or longer and may occur hundreds of times per night. The result is fragmented sleep, plummeting oxygen levels, and a cascade of health consequences that extend far beyond feeling tired.

In the UAE, studies estimate that 25–30% of adults have some form of sleep-disordered breathing, yet the vast majority remain undiagnosed. Factors common in the region — including higher obesity rates, sedentary lifestyles, and hot climates that limit outdoor exercise — contribute to elevated prevalence.

Obstructive (OSA)

The most common type. Throat muscles relax and block the airway during sleep, causing breathing pauses and oxygen drops. Accounts for 84% of cases.

Central (CSA)

The brain fails to send proper signals to breathing muscles. Less common, often associated with heart failure or neurological conditions.

Complex / Mixed

A combination of obstructive and central sleep apnea. Typically identified when OSA does not resolve fully with initial CPAP therapy.

Normal
AHI < 5
Fewer than 5 events per hour
Mild
AHI 5–15
5 to 15 events per hour of sleep
Moderate
AHI 15–30
15 to 30 events per hour of sleep
Severe
AHI 30+
More than 30 events per hour

Common Symptoms of Sleep Apnea

Recognising the signs early is the first step toward effective treatment. If you experience two or more of these regularly, consider a sleep evaluation.

Loud, chronic snoring — often reported by a partner
Witnessed pauses in breathing during sleep
Waking up gasping or choking at night
Excessive daytime sleepiness despite 7+ hours of sleep
Morning headaches and persistent brain fog
High blood pressure or irregular heartbeat
Irritability, mood swings, or depression
Frequent nighttime urination (nocturia)

Who Is at Risk for Sleep Apnea?

While sleep apnea can affect anyone, certain factors significantly increase your likelihood of developing the condition.

Excess Weight

BMI over 30 increases risk by 3–5x. Fat deposits around the upper airway can obstruct breathing.

Age & Gender

Risk increases with age, particularly after 40. Men are 2–3x more likely to develop OSA than pre-menopausal women.

Anatomy

A narrow airway, large tonsils, recessed jaw, or neck circumference over 17 inches elevate risk significantly.

Family History

Having a first-degree relative with sleep apnea increases your risk by up to 2x due to inherited airway traits.

Lifestyle Factors

Smoking, alcohol use, and sedative medications relax airway muscles and worsen obstruction during sleep.

Medical Conditions

Hypertension, type 2 diabetes, congestive heart failure, and PCOS are all associated with higher OSA prevalence.

Sleep Apnea Treatment Options in Dubai

Treatment depends on severity. Most patients respond well to non-invasive options, and Noxify includes a complimentary CPAP trial with every positive diagnosis.

CPAP Therapy

The first-line treatment for moderate-to-severe OSA. A small device delivers gentle air pressure to keep your airway open during sleep.

95% effective when used consistently
Noxify offers a complimentary multi-night trial
Modern devices are whisper-quiet and compact

Oral Appliance Therapy

A custom-fitted dental device that repositions the jaw to keep the airway open. Best suited for mild-to-moderate OSA.

Custom-fitted by a sleep dentist
Portable and travel-friendly
Ideal for patients who cannot tolerate CPAP

Lifestyle Modifications

Weight loss, positional therapy, and reducing alcohol intake can significantly reduce symptoms in mild cases.

10% weight loss can reduce AHI by 50%
Sleeping on your side reduces obstruction
Avoiding alcohol 3h before bed helps

Surgical Options

Reserved for cases where other treatments fail. Procedures aim to remove tissue or reposition structures blocking the airway.

UPPP, MMA, or hypoglossal nerve stimulation
Typically a last resort after CPAP/OAT
Evaluated on a case-by-case basis

Why Early Diagnosis Matters

Untreated sleep apnea doesn't just disrupt your sleep — it dramatically increases your risk of life-threatening conditions.

3× Heart Disease Risk

Severe OSA triples the risk of coronary artery disease, heart failure, and atrial fibrillation.

4× Stroke Risk

Untreated moderate-to-severe sleep apnea quadruples the likelihood of having a stroke.

Type 2 Diabetes

OSA disrupts insulin regulation. Up to 71% of type 2 diabetes patients have comorbid sleep apnea.

7× Accident Risk

Daytime drowsiness from untreated OSA makes drivers 7× more likely to be involved in a motor vehicle accident.

80%of moderate-to-severe sleep apnea cases remain undiagnosed
